A thesis statement concisely expresses the argument an essay makes and indicates to readers what the writer knows about the topic. Particularly in shorter essays, the thesis statement is often one sentence placed at the end of the introduction; the body of the essay then provides evidence to prove that thesis. ... A strong thesis statement has a specific topic, makes an arguable claim, and is written in a concise manner. The language used in a thesis statement is clear and field-specific rather than complex and full of jargon. A “working thesis” evolves into a strong thesis statement through drafting and revision as your ideas develop.

A thesis statement is a concise sentence or two that clearly articulates the main point or argument of an academic paper, essay, or thesis. It serves as the foundation of the document, guiding the reader through the purpose and scope of the research or discussion. A strong thesis statement provides clarity, focus, and direction, making it an essential component of effective writing.
